Participants were exposed to gradual light improve from 300 to a maximum of 2000 lux, and were asked about the visual discomfort intensity (VAS) induced by the light. For balance assessment, participants stood upright inside a bipedal position on a force platform for 30 seconds inside the following light situations: 1) visual threshold, in which light induce the minimal visual discomfort; 2) visual discomfort, in which light induce moderate-to-intense visual discomfort; and 3) control, with only ceiling light space (270 lux). Participants performed three trials for each condition. Light intensity was measured by a digital luximeter positioned at participant’s eye level. All participants had been assessed during the interictal period. A repeated measures ANOVA with LSD post-hoc (p0.05) was utilized to examine the center of stress (CoP) ellipse area as well as the CoP speed amongst the three light circumstances. Results: We identified a median visual 5′-?Uridylic acid Autophagy threshold equal to 450 lux (IQR 400 to 600) and a median visual discomfort of 2000 lux (IQR 1900 to 2000). Migraineurs showed bigger CoP area at the visual discomfort condition in comparison with the visual threshold and control circumstances (p0.05). CoP speed at the visual discomfort situation was greater than the other circumstances tested, but with no statistical distinction (Table 1). Conclusion: Visual discomfort induced by light intensity manipulation increased the CoP region of migraineurs individuals in bipedal quiet stance.References 1.
